Virginia-Based Bank Expands Private Wealth Team

Virginia-based Monarch Bank has appointed Benjamin Vanderberry as executive vice president to support the growth of its private wealth offering.

The majority of Vanderberry’s experience is in wealth management, private banking and commercial lending.

He previously worked at Suntrust Bank as the private wealth management group’s credit strategy officer, as well as mid-Atlantic credit advisory services manager and regional private wealth manager for Hampton Roads - a metropolitan region in southeastern Virginia.

Monarch Bank is a community bank with 11 offices in Chesapeake, Virginia Beach, Norfolk, Suffolk, and Williamsburg, VA.

E Neal Crawford, president of Monarch Bank, said that the firm’s private wealth team “joined us from the same bank over two years ago.”

“His credit skills and previous oversight of private bank lending throughout the southeastern US will add greatly to our ability to grow loans to this targeted group of clients in our markets,” Crawford said.
